The duration of a transatlantic journey from Dallas, Texas, to Dublin, Ireland, typically ranges between eight and nine hours on a nonstop flight. Connecting flights, involving one or more layovers, can significantly extend the overall travel time, often exceeding twelve hours depending on the routing and layover duration. Several factors influence the precise duration, including prevailing winds, aircraft type, and specific flight paths. A traveler might experience a slightly shorter eastbound trip due to favorable jet stream currents.

4. Prevailing Winds

Prevailing winds, specifically the jet stream, significantly influence transatlantic flight times between Dallas and Dublin. The jet stream, a high-altitude air current, flows eastward across the North Atlantic. Flights from Dallas to Dublin, traveling eastward, often benefit from a tailwind generated by the jet stream. This tailwind effectively increases the aircraft’s ground speed, reducing travel time. Conversely, westbound flights from Dublin to Dallas face headwinds, increasing travel time. The strength and position of the jet stream vary seasonally, impacting flight durations throughout the year. During winter months, the jet stream typically strengthens and shifts southward, resulting in stronger tailwinds for eastbound flights and correspondingly shorter travel times. Summer months typically see a weaker, more northerly jet stream, leading to less pronounced effects on flight durations. For example, a flight from Dallas to Dublin might take eight hours with a strong tailwind but closer to nine hours with a weaker tailwind or even longer when facing headwinds.

Airlines consider prevailing wind patterns when planning routes and scheduling flights. Flight planning software incorporates jet stream forecasts to optimize flight paths and minimize fuel consumption. Taking advantage of tailwinds and avoiding strong headwinds contributes to fuel efficiency and cost savings for airlines. Understanding prevailing wind patterns also assists pilots in making real-time adjustments to flight plans during the journey. Pilots may choose to alter altitude or slightly adjust their course to maximize tailwind benefits or minimize headwind impacts, further optimizing flight duration and fuel efficiency. This dynamic interaction between prevailing winds and flight planning highlights the practical significance of meteorological understanding in commercial aviation.

6. Time of Year

Time of year influences flight duration between Dallas and Dublin due to variations in the jet stream’s strength and position. The jet stream, a high-altitude wind current, flows eastward across the North Atlantic. During winter, the jet stream strengthens and shifts southward, producing stronger tailwinds for eastbound flights. These tailwinds reduce travel time from Dallas to Dublin. Conversely, westbound flights during winter encounter stronger headwinds, increasing travel time. Summer sees a weaker, more northerly jet stream, leading to less pronounced impacts on flight duration in either direction. For example, a January flight from Dallas to Dublin might experience significantly shorter travel time than a July flight due to the stronger winter jet stream. This seasonal variation requires consideration when planning travel, particularly for time-sensitive itineraries.

Beyond the jet stream, weather systems also contribute to seasonal variations in flight times. Winter storms over the North Atlantic can cause flight delays or necessitate longer routes to avoid adverse weather conditions. These disruptions can increase overall travel time. Summer weather, while generally more stable, can still present challenges. Thunderstorms or periods of heavy precipitation near Dallas or Dublin airports can cause delays. While these delays are usually shorter than those caused by winter storms, they still require consideration when planning travel. Airlines adjust flight schedules and routing to mitigate weather-related disruptions, but some seasonal variation in flight times remains. Tip 6: Factor in Time Zone Differences: The significant time difference between Dallas and Dublin (six hours during standard time, five during daylight saving time) necessitates careful planning to minimize jet lag. Adjusting sleep schedules before departure and upon arrival facilitates smoother acclimatization.
